    The Battle at the Cape of Italy.C. F. Konrad - 2017 - Hermes 145 (2):143-158.
    Contrary to the widely held view that the Roman-Carthaginian naval encounter Polybios reports at 1.21.9-11 was separate from the one off Mylae (260 BC) told at length right afterwards (1.23), the battle at the ‘Cape of Italy’ is in fact - as suspected by some scholars long ago - identical with the one at Mylae. However, far from mistaking (as has been suggested) Philinos’ account of the latter for a separate engagement, Polybios knowingly and deliberately told the battle of Mylae (...)

  9. Sequence semantics for dynamic predicate logic.C. F. M. Vermeulen - 1993 - Journal of Logic, Language and Information 2 (3):217-254.
    In this paper a semantics for dynamic predicate logic is developed that uses sequence valued assignments. This semantics is compared with the usual relational semantics for dynamic predicate logic: it is shown that the most important intuitions of the usual semantics are preserved. Then it is shown that the refined semantics reflects out intuitions about information growth. Some other issues in dynamic semantics are formulated and discussed in terms of the new sequence semantics.
